Definition

  1. 1
    Espace de terrain considéré comme propre à y construire un bâtiment, à y tracer un jardin, à y exercer un commerce ou une industrie, etc.
  2. 2
    Lieu où se situe quelque chose ou quelqu’un.
  3. 3
    Lieu où se situait quelque chose qui a disparu.
